Understanding Online Tests

Online tests describe assessments administered through the web, incorporating a broad variety of formats that range from multiple-choice questions to complex simulations.  ADHD Assessment Test For Adults  can be utilized for instructional evaluations, professional accreditations, or perhaps casual self-assessments.

Why Choose Online Testing?

The increasing choice for online testing can be attributed to numerous factors, consisting of:

  • Accessibility: Students and professionals can take assessments from anywhere and at any time, reducing geographical barriers.
  • Efficiency: Automated grading systems conserve time and supply immediate feedback, permitting for quicker adjustments in teaching and knowing techniques.
  • Cost-Effectiveness: Online tests often reduce the costs connected with physical testing places, printing, and materials.
  • Versatility: Test-takers can often choose their time slots, boosting the total testing experience.
  • Advanced Features: Online platforms can integrate multimedia elements, replicate real-world circumstances, or use adaptive testing based on user performance.

Difficulties of Online Testing

Regardless of the clear advantages, online testing also presents several difficulties that organizations and organizations need to think about:

  • Technical Issues: Internet connection problems or software application breakdowns can interrupt the testing procedure.
  • Security Risks: Concerns concerning unfaithful and data stability require robust security steps.
  • Test Integrity: Ensuring that the individual taking the test is the registered candidate stays an important difficulty.
  • Accessibility Concerns: While online tests can be available, challenges still exist for people with specials needs who might require particular accommodations.

Carrying Out Online Testing

For institutions considering the transition to online testing, numerous best practices can assist guarantee a successful implementation:

Choose the Right Platform:

  • Evaluate different online testing platforms based upon features, ease of usage, security, and assistance.

Integrate Security Measures:

  • Use proctoring services, keeping track of software application, and secure internet browsers to mitigate cheating dangers.

Offer Clear Instructions:

  • Ensure that test-takers have thorough standards on how to browse the online platform.

Pilot Before Going Live:

  • Conduct a trial run with a small group to identify possible concerns before the full deployment.

Train Educators and Administrators:

  • Ensure that all workers included are fluent in the innovation and procedures related to online testing.

The Future of Online Testing

The pattern towards online assessments reveals no signs of slowing down. As technology continues to develop, several interesting advancements might form the future of online testing:

  • Artificial Intelligence: The combination of AI may offer customized testing experiences and advanced cheating detection.
  • Virtual Reality: With improvements in VR innovation, immersive simulations could alter the landscape of practical evaluations.
  • Data Analytics: Enhanced data collection and analysis might offer insights into test-taking patterns and discovering practices, helping to personalize instructional approaches.
